new lines from an edit text component

Hi,
I am building a small gui using GUIDE and have a multiline edit text box. I would like to consider each line seperately. Is it possible to obtain the string in the edit box as a cell array with an element for each line?

Assuming h is the handle to your uicontrol ...
s = get(h, 'string');
scell = mat2cell(s, ones(size(s, 1), 1), size(s, 2));

One only gets back a character array from a uicontrol if one initialized to a character array or character vector and does not change it afterwards.
There are an exceptions to this:
  • if one created a popup or listbox from a character vector that has embedded '|' characters, then each '|' marks the end of a string, and the character vector with '|' will be converted to a cell array.
edit boxes do not break lines at '|' characters.
My recollection is that if a user edits a multi-line edit box then they will get a cell array back even if the original was a character array or character vector.
